Rachel Stone is just broke enough and just desperate enough to return to Salvation, North Carolina. She needs to take care of her son, and despite the fact that her dead husband, televangelist G. Dwayne Snopes stole millions of dollars and humiliated Rachel, it's the only place she can go. She's hoping to find her dead husband's treasure in order to survive. She ends up Gabe Bonner's drive-in, finds a job, and faces down her enemies.

Gabe is also the current occupant of Rachel's old home, leading her to deceive him as she searches for the treasure. Making things more difficult is the fact that Gabe is tortured by the deaths of his wife and child -- just looking at Rachel's son causes him deep pain. The interaction between Gabe and Edward (aka Chip) is heart-wrenching and inspiring.

Dream A Little Dream is a story of redemption and strength. While Phillips's ability to write funny is in full force, this book also has its shares of tear-jerking moments. There is a secondary romance featuring Gabe's brother Ethan, a pastor, and his secretary Kristy that is equally well-drawn.
